Embark on a journey into Hungarian tradition with a Danube river cruise featuring a folklore show and a delightful four-course dinner.

Activity Details

Your Danube cruise departs from Pier 11 of Pet?fi tér. Enjoy an evening in Budapest as the boat navigates the river, showcasing the stunning illuminated cityscape. A talented musical ensemble and folk dancers in authentic attire will enhance the experience with traditional dances and captivating performances featuring the cimbalom, a prominent instrument in regional folk music. The cruise lasts for 2 hours and returns to the departure pier.

Tour Options

During booking, choose from two options for your Danube cruise:

Cruise with Show & Drinks

This option includes the show and offers 3 drinks per person during the cruise.

Cruise with Show & Dinner

This option includes a delicious 4-course dinner along with the folklore show, featuring a welcome drink and the chance to purchase additional beverages on board. The menu includes:
